Martin Girard
Montreal
Martin Girard’s photos lead one to the heart of the story. Through his mastery of photomontage and image processing, he has been able to develop a unique style, with a recognisable touch of humour, fantasy, and mystery. His mind is filled with clever tricks, he has a wonderful talent for creating singular atmospheres so much so that the backgrounds in his photos often become characters in their own right. Versatile and bold, he is well known for being intimately involved with his projects, from the idea stage to completion, making him an ideal team leader in the production of large-scale images.
Founding partner at Shoot Studio, one of the largest photo/video production house in Quebec, his work has garnered him many professional awards over the years: PDN, Archive, Young Guns, Communication Arts, and Applied Arts and more.
Clients include Dell, Bombardier, Capital One, Cirque du Soleil, Moment Factory, Nespresso, Nivea, Quebec’s Casinos and more.

Epic Mind Studio
Montreal
Based out of Montreal, Canada, Epic Mind Studio is headed by Vadim Chiline, a commercial photographer and videographer with over a decade of specialisation in the world of luxury.
His work showcases his mastery of jewellery and gemstones. Additionally, having a life-long passion for timepieces, he has a relentless drive to photograph watches in all kinds of positions. With clients spanning the globe, he enjoys collaborating with ideas from all corners. His style is described as moody and highly contrasted, yet enjoys simplicity over convoluted scenes.
The studio is equipped with a medium format camera system, as well as HD and 4k video cameras that include slow motion capabilities and a digital motion control rig. Working with the latest Apple workstations and software, the studio includes a kitchenette, changing room, meeting area and has two concurrent photography stations if needed.
Located in a beautifully restored historic building facing the Lachine Canal, clients are located within a quick five-minute drive from Montreal's busy and delicious center.
